Full Cast & Crew of Wintertime

  • Sonja Henie – Nora Ostgaard
  • Jack Oakie – Skip Hutton
  • Cesar Romero – Brad Barton
  • Carole Landis – Flossie Fouchere
  • S.Z. Sakall – Hjalmar Ostgaard
